Information and Advice Officer (Part-time)
Do you have a background in customer care, excellent communication skills and a desire to help people in their later life?
Age UK Somerset is an independent local charity leading teams of staff and volunteers to provide information and other services that create opportunities for people in later life.
Our Information & Advice team is at the heart of our organisation, providing a service directly to older people and others who need advice on issues affecting older people.
We are pleased to invite applications for the following part-time fixed term role, based in our Taunton office.
Hours: Salary: Location: |
Part Time 3 days a week, 21 hours per week £22,557.40 p.a. FTE (£13,534.44 actual) Taunton |
‘Information & Advice’ is a free, confidential service that aims to provide information to older people that enables them to make choices and decisions to enhance their quality of life.
As one of our Information & Advice Officers, you will offer telephone (and occasional face-to-face) support to our clients, their families and carers on a wide range of issues.
The role also involves helping people with welfare benefit forms and carrying out benefit entitlement checks for older people, so relevant and recent knowledge would be beneficial but training will be provided.
You should be committed to providing a quality service, using your listening and questioning skills to deal with all requests sensitively, discreetly and appropriately. The role requires that you complete your own administration, so the ability to keep accurate, detailed records on our database will also be key to your success within the role.
In return this rewarding role offers a pleasant working environment within our modern Taunton office, working alongside our friendly team. Free car parking is available.
Appointment to this post is subject to satisfactory references.
